Qingdao Ovis Energy-Saving Materials Co., Ltd. has established a product system centered around zirconia series, natural flake graphite series, and lithium battery new material series products.
The company's fused zirconia series products can adopt different composite processes such as calcium and yttrium according to customer needs, with complete specifications and support for customized production to meet various customer requirements and applications.
The company's natural flake graphite series products are sourced from exclusive cooperative mines, integrating development and production. The conventional specifications include 595, 895, 599, 899, etc., and can be customized according to customer requirements to meet the needs of different customers.
The company also possesses a grinding and processing capacity of 60,000 mt of lithium battery anode materials, undertakes external processing business, and provides efficient and reliable processing services to customers.

Sungrow: The Global Energy Storage Market Is Expected to Grow by 30–50 in 2026
At a conference call on March 31, Sungrow stated regarding the company’s overall target plan for energy storage shipments in 2026 that the global market is expected to grow by 30–50 in 2026. With raw material prices rising, some projects were in a wait-and-see stage, but the demand should still exist and would only be deferred. The company will strive based on the upper end of market growth, hoping to achieve more than 60 Gwh.

SK Innovation E&S Launches Largest ESS Facility in New York
SK Innovation E&S has completed and begun operations of the largest energy storage system (ESS) facility in New York State. According to industry sources on the 31st, its subsidiary KCE launched the KCE NY 6 battery storage facility located on Electric Avenue in Blasdell, Erie County. The project, with a capacity of 20MW (45.6MWh), is the largest single ESS site constructed in New York at the time of its commissioning and is directly connected to the local power grid.

Tozero Launches Industrial Demo Plant to Recover Lithium from Waste Batteries
German company, Tozero, announced on March 27 (local time) the official launch of its industrial-scale demonstration plant. The company has built a facility at the Gendorf chemical park in Bavaria, Germany, capable of processing more than 1,500 tons of waste batteries annually. The process enables the recovery of lithium carbonate, graphite, and nickel-cobalt mixtures from spent batteries for reuse as battery raw materials. The plant is expected to recycle resources equivalent to batteries from approximately 6,000 electric vehicles per year, reducing reliance on landfill disposal.
